The Journey


Each session forms part of a cohesive arc, supporting you from beginning to completion of your woven piece:


Session One: Ritual Warping


An initiation into the loom as ally, altar, and teacher. You’ll be guided through grounding practices and a ceremonial approach to warping, exploring warp as structure, intention, and spine.


Session Two: Spinning Spells


A descent into the fluid realm of fibre. This session explores the alchemy of twist, drop spindle techniques, fibre preparation, and the energetic and ancestral dimensions of spinning and natural dye.


Session Three: Weaving the Cloth


A hands-on exploration of weaving as breath and expression. You’ll be guided through rhythm, tension, selvedges, and symbolic patterning as you begin to bring your cloth to life.


Session Four: Birthing the Cloth


A completion and integration. Learn how to finish and release your cloth from the loom, with guidance on washing, fulling, and final touches, alongside reflective practices to honour what has been woven within and without.


Materials You Will Need

  • A Rigid Heddle Loom (any size)
  • A Drop Spindle
  • Yarn for warping and weaving
  • Fibre for spinning
  • Warping tools (typically included in a Rigid Heddle kit)


While a rigid heddle loom is encouraged for its ease and versatility, you are welcome to work with whatever weaving tools you have. The process can be adapted to suit your materials.


Small handwoven panels can also be stitched together with intention to form a cohesive womb wrap—your cloth will still carry the magic of presence, time, and breath.
